Free speech and dog walking

November 29, 2011

Toronto Star
With occupiers’ tents coming down all over the place, it is timely to take stock of Canadians’ attachments to free speech. For those living in the vicinity of Toronto’s St. James Park, we know that the occupiers tested their… Read more here